A leading technology-driven financial services company is seeking a Director of Financial and Enterprise Communications to oversee critical communications initiatives, elevate executive visibility, and drive compelling storytelling across key audiences. Partnering closely with senior leadership, you’ll steer financial communications, manage corporate milestones, and support enterprise-wide messaging with precision and impact.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ead communications strategy for major financial milestones, including quarterly earnings, M&A announcements, Investor Days, and related events.
- Develop, lead, and execute a comprehensive thought-leadership platform for the CFO across internal and external channels.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with financial, industry, trade, and general business media.
- Create communications plans, media strategies, and press materials to shape the company’s narrative among investors, analysts, and financial press.
- Secure speaking engagements and media opportunities to elevate C-suite visibility and strengthen executive thought leadership.
- Support enterprise communications across non-revenue functions, corporate initiatives, and special projects.
- Play a key role in issues and crisis communications, ensuring timely, transparent, and effective messaging during sensitive situations.
- Collaborate cross-functionally with internal and external partners to drive alignment and deliver clear, consistent communications.
The Ideal Candidate
- Bachelor’s degree in communications, journalism, marketing, finance, or a related field.
- Minimum of 6 years' experience supporting public companies through financial communications or public campaigns (agency or in-house).
- Strong understanding of financial communications strategies and the ability to integrate digital and social channels.
- Exceptional ability to translate complex concepts into clear, concise, and compelling narratives.
- Highly organized project manager who thrives in fast-moving environments and consistently meets deadlines.
- Motivated self-starter with a roll-up-your-sleeves mentality and the ability to take initiative while collaborating effectively.
- Skilled at navigating large organizations and driving cross-functional alignment.
- Strong media-handling skills and strong experience engaging financial and business press.
- Creative, strategic thinker with exceptional judgment and problem-solving abilities.
- Superior written, verbal, and interpersonal communication skills.
Title: Director, Financial and Enterprise Communications
Location: New York City, New York
Workplace Type: Hybrid
Salary: $160,000 - $180,000
